在Android Studio中更改API版本


简介

首先,在更改API(应用程序编程接口)版本之前,我们必须了解什么是Android API及其用途。Android API是一种应用程序编程接口,它允许我们向Android应用程序添加特定功能。简单来说,Android API是用于开发Android应用程序的一套工具。API版本用于开发人员确保其应用程序与当前版本的Android操作系统兼容。Android手机也使用它来确定哪些应用程序与其设备兼容。

API版本是Android软件开发工具包(SDK)的重要组成部分。当开发人员创建Android应用程序时,他们必须指定他们所针对的API版本。这确保应用程序将与运行指定版本的Android操作系统的设备兼容。API版本还有助于设备确定哪些应用程序可供其下载。

API版本是指Android版本,它告诉开发人员他们的应用程序目标运行的API版本。由于我们正在开发此Android应用程序以在Google Play商店上发布。为了发布此应用程序,我们必须满足要求,其中之一是设置API级别。要更改API版本,开发人员必须设置minSdkVersion和targetSdkVersion。

  • minSdkVersion − 最小SDK版本(最小软件开发工具包版本)是Android应用程序开发中的一个重要概念。它指定了构建应用程序时使用的Android SDK(软件开发工具包)的最低版本。了解此概念非常重要,因为它会影响应用程序在不同设备上的行为。这意味着支持该应用程序的最低Android操作系统版本。

  • targetSdkVersion − 目标SDK版本是Android开发人员在为Android设备开发应用程序时需要考虑的重要设置。简而言之,它是您选择将应用程序定位到的Android SDK版本。目标SDK版本用于定义应用程序的行为、外观和限制。这意味着开发人员实际开发其应用程序的版本。

有两种方法可用于更改任何Android Studio项目的API版本,如下所示:

  • 从build.gradle文件更改项目的API版本。

  • 通过项目结构更改项目的API版本。

方法1:从build.gradle更改项目的API版本

导航到您的Android Studio项目。在左侧选项卡中的项目中,您必须导航到app>Gradle Scripts>build.gradle(应用程序级别)。在这个build.gradle文件中,您将看到一个默认的config部分,其中您将看到目标SDK版本和最小SDK版本。这是您的项目当前正在使用的库的Android API版本。您可以将这两个值更改为市场上最新的可用版本,也可以根据您的需求降低版本。除此之外,有时您还会在代码本身中看到对最新可用API版本的建议。在最小SDK版本和目标SDK版本的代码中,您将看到它以黄色突出显示。您必须单击黄色的灯泡,它会告诉您项目最新的可用API版本,然后您可以相应地更新它。更新API版本后,请务必单击“立即同步”选项以同步您的Gradle文件。

方法2:通过项目结构更改项目的API版本

导航到您的Android Studio项目。在项目内部,单击“文件”(您可以在顶部的工具栏中看到),然后单击“项目结构”。单击它后,您必须导航到“模块”选项卡。在此模块选项卡中,选择“app”,然后单击“默认配置”选项卡以查看默认配置。在此处,您将看到目标SDK版本和最小SDK版本。您可以根据需要从此处更改您的SDK版本。更新后,只需单击“应用”和“确定”即可将这些更改添加到您的项目中。您的项目将同步,并且项目的API版本将按提及的那样更改。

注意 − 请注意,更改API版本可能需要更新您的代码以确保与新版本兼容。您可能还需要更新您的依赖项以确保它们与新版本兼容。

结论

在本文中,我们了解了如何在Android Studio中使用两种不同的方法更改项目的API版本。

更新于:2023年5月8日

7K+ 次浏览

启动您的职业生涯

通过完成课程获得认证

开始
广告